[IMP] website: add an aria-label on the extra item anchor The goal of this commit is to add an `aria-label` attribute on the "extra item" anchor in order to improve the accessibility of the website pages and avoid a warning of type `Links do not have a discernible name`. However, as the logic responsible of the creation of this anchor is in a non lazy loaded file, the translate function `_t()` (located in a lazy loaded file) can not be used to translate the value of the `aria-label` attribute. To solve the problem, this value has been put in the `data-extra-items-toggle-aria-label` attribute on the header. The translated value is then extracted and added in the `aria-label` attribute at the extra items button creation. ------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------ [IMP] website: add a default meta description on website pages The goal of this commit is to add a default meta description on website homepage and "contact us" page in order to improve their SEO and avoid a warning of type `Document does not have a meta description`. ------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------ [IMP] website: add an aria-controls attribute on accordion tab elements In order to improve the accessibility of the website pages, an `aria-controls` attribute has been added on `tab` elements of the "Accordion" snippet to avoid a warning of type `Elements with an ARIA [role] that require children to contain a specific [role] are missing some or all of those required children`. Indeed, as explained in [the tab role documentation]; "An element with the `tab` role should contain the `aria-controls` property identifying a corresponding `tabpanel` (that has a `tabpanel` role) by that element's `id`". The `_createIDs()` method has been adapted in order to handle the update of the `aria-controls` attribute at the update of the `tabpanel` id. This update fixes an issue where expense totals were incorrectly calculated due to using the current exchange rate instead of the rate at the time the expense was incurred. The change ensures accurate totals in the 'totals to submit' section, improving the reliability of expense reporting. This impacts users who record expenses in multiple currencies.
Original PR description
## Issue: - Expenses entered in currencies other than the company currency are incorrectly calculated using today's exchange rate instead of the rate applicable on the date the expense was made. This results in inaccurate totals in the "totals to submit" section of the Expenses dashboard. ## Steps To Reproduce: - Go to Expenses. - See the current total to submit. - Create a new expense that is 999,999 EUR but $1.00 USD. - See that the expenses to submit is not matching the exchange rate we put in the expense. ## Solution: - In the 'get_expense_dashboard' method instead of summing up of 'total_amount_currency' and then converting to the company currency. we sum up directly the 'total_amount' for each expense instead. opw-3731445 --- I confirm I have signed the CLA and read the PR guidelines at www.odoo.com/submit-pr Forward-Port-Of: odoo/odoo#156591 Forward-Port-Of: odoo/odoo#155221
This update improves the speed of creating orderpoints in the stock management system. Previously, the process was slow due to inefficient data retrieval. This change streamlines the process, significantly reducing the time taken to create orderpoints and improving overall system performance.
Original PR description
This commit changes the computation of product having a negative forecasted quantity to create manual orderpoints. The issue was that each replenish location needed multiple `_read_group` on…
This commit changes the computation of product having a negative forecasted quantity to create manual orderpoints. The issue was that each replenish location needed multiple `_read_group` on `stock.quant` and `stock.move` on all storable product. This commit makes only 3 `_read_group`s for all products x locations and post process the group and quantity sum by location in Python. This method gives some performance gain in time as well as in memory consumption Task: 3653272 Here is the time comparison before/after the patch for different configuration | | before | after | |---|---|---| | 700 loc, 300 prod | 14.08s | 850ms | |10 loc, 3k prod | 2.174s | 349ms | |700 loc, 30k prod | TO | 74s | Description of the issue/feature this PR addresses: Current behavior before PR: Desired behavior after PR is merged: --- I confirm I have signed the CLA and read the PR guidelines at www.odoo.com/submit-pr Forward-Port-Of: odoo/odoo#156507 Forward-Port-Of: odoo/odoo#149966

Forward-Port-Of: odoo/odoo#156495This update optimizes how Odoo routes incoming emails by adding an index to the `mail.alias` table. Previously, searching email aliases was slow due to inefficient database queries. This change dramatically speeds up email routing, particularly for high-volume email processing, leading to a more responsive system.
Original PR description
## Description Since https://github.com/odoo/odoo/pull/76734, the new field `alias_full_name` is used in addition to `alias_name` to search on `mail.alias` and route emails in `message_route`. It's…
## Description
Since https://github.com/odoo/odoo/pull/76734, the new field `alias_full_name` is used in addition to `alias_name` to search on `mail.alias` and route emails in `message_route`. It's also used as a search criteria in `_search_alias_email` on `mail.alias.mixin. optional`. The issue is that the table `mail.alias` can grow quite large, and only the old field `alias_name` has an index on it, which may not be selective enough, forcing Seq.Scans on the table with possibly millions of records. The impact is noticeable on `message_route` which is a hot path for processing incoming emails.
Adding an index on `alias_full_name` allows PostgreSQL to do an bitmap OR scan on the two indexes, considerably speeding up search criteria that are a disjunction between `alias_name` and `alias_full_name`.
## Benchmark
For domain
```python
[
'&',
('alias_model_id', '!=', reply_model_id),
'|',
('alias_full_name', 'in', email_to_list),
'&', ('alias_name', 'in', email_to_localparts), ('alias_incoming_local', '=', True),
]
```
with test arguments, on a `mail.alias` table containing over 2M records.
| | Before | After |
|-----------|--------|-------|
| Timing | 696ms | 1ms |
| Buffer IO | 790MB | 48KB |
Specially impactful as those gains needs to be multiplied by the frequency of the searches.
